Changes for version 0.57

  • Learned that CPAN UNKNOWN test results are not just indications that a tester hasn't gotten around to testing the module yet! They are actual test reports that can be opened, and contain worse (more basic) problems than FAIL results!
  • Learned that some UNKNOWNs for 0.56 were due to use of "IS_NUMBER..." symbols that are not provided by older Perl systems
  • Used Devel::PPPort to add ppport.h file to distribution
  • Included (in C preprocessor sense) ppport.h in MMA.xs
  • With help of script in ppport.h, defined two symbols in MMA.xs that make ppport.h define required "IS_NUMBER..." symbols when they're not provided by an older Perl
  • Added prerequisite for latest version of ExtUtils::ParseXS, an attempt to avoid some nasty-looking warnings in 'make' step, that I had just battled through on my own system
  • revised t/9_lock.t in response to FAIL on 0.56
  • added Devel::CheckOS to distribution and Makefile.PL, to restrict IPC::MMA install to OSes that mm runs on (Still no change to IPC::MMA itself since 0.54)
